Description of changes:
The fix in #112 had the side effect of calling
type_castonnilif thedefault_valuewas unset.Because the
StringSetMarshalerandNumericSetMarshalerboth convertniltoSet.new, this caused the unset default value in practice to becomeSet.newinstead ofnil.Ultimately this caused downstream effects such as always persisting empty or unset sets as
